Try this site: http://www.loaches.com/species-index/weather-loach-misgurnis-anguillicaudatus
It says: "Because of their sociability, they should not be kept singly as they like to sit in groups when at rest. They will often sidle up against one another and feel one another with their barbels."
It also says: "A group of three should be the minimum and even that small of a group will need quite a spacious aquarium."
Apparently they get up to 10 inches long.
